I am sure you will not mind if I differ a little, and add a little more, here and there. The first thing I feel bound to say is: Try to write in prose, and not in bullet points. The reasons for this, we can discuss another time. In press releases, the main thing you are trying to do is to complete as much of the journalist's work as you possibly can, so as to make it very easy for the journalist to use your story. In doing so, you must realise that most of the time, if only by the law of averages, the journalist is not going to be able to get a long story in the paper. This is why you must be brief. In other words: Don't give the journalist the hard work of reducing the length. Do it yourself. Write like a journalist would write. In short sentences. And also, in short paragraphs. The journalist is going to have to contact somebody. Your e-mail by itself is not enough. There will have to be a phone call, as well. Therefore you must put a phone number at the bottom. No phone number, no story. I would also say: Do state the obvious. Do not presume that the journalist, or the reader, knows what may be obvious to you. But also, do not, if you can possibly avoid it, try to tell more than one story in a press release. Instead, make two or more press releases. Your stories will have much better chances of getting published, that way. Try to restrict yourself to one idea per sentence (average 20 words per sentence). • Keep press releases to one page if possible (three to six paragraphs) • State clearly who the press release is to and where it is from • Discard unrelated or unnecessary information • Don’t state the obvious - nobody has the time On 22 February 2013 17:21, morgan phaahla <[email protected]><mailto:[email protected]>> wrote: Greetings!
